NEW POST OFFICE

OPENED AT PAEKAKARIKI,

\ new post office was opened at Paekakariki on Saturday afternoon by the Postmaster-General (Hon. J. G. Coates). The Minister was accompanied /by Mrs. Coates and the member for the distrct, Mr. W. 11. Field. The building, which was recently completed, is a combined post' office and postmistress's residence. It includes a telephone bureau, a telephone exchange, and a set of private The Minister congratulated the township on the improved accommodation, lie mentioned that the first post office was opened at Paekaknriki in 1569. in those days the mail coach from ellington inn through Paekakariki to Wanganui. Ihe iouracy was almost entirely .'.long the beachi In later years, of course, tho mails have been conveyed by tram. Air. Coates said that the growing importance of Paekakariki fully justified the erection of the new post office.
